Evelyne Rose (Bouvier) Legasey, of Auburn passed away in her sleep Wednesday April 4, 2012 at Millbury Health Care Center . She was 86.
She leaves her husband of 65 yearsWilliam F. Legasey, Jr., her daughter Sandra Lee Legasey-Feldman and her husband Glenn Feldman of Auburn, 4 grandaughters Jennifer Holmes of Dennisport,Deirdre Legasey of Auburn,Caroline Shea of Leicester and Jessica Johnson of Oxford.She also leaves 7 great grandchildren,her brothers Napoleon and Milton Armour, sisters Eva Bassett and Shirley Williams, daughter in-law Catherine Shugrue-Legasey and brother- in- law and sister- in-law Vernon and Marion Burke. She also leaves her cat Chubba Bubba who she adopted from the Kathleen Sabina Animal Compound.
She is preceded in death by her son Mark W. Legasey, her sister Lillian Bouvier and brothers Clifford and Clarence Bouvier and her mother and father-in-law Florence and William Legasey Sr.
Evelyne was born in Sutton. She was the daughter of the late Peter Bouvier of Canada.
Mrs. Legasey was a 1943 graduate of Sutton High and later attended Salter Secretarial School.
She worked for the Telephone Co., and for Denholm McKay and later for the former Cherry Webb Touraine prior to retiring.
Mrs. Legasey was a member of the First Congregational Church in Auburn and taught at its Sunday school for many years.
She loved to paint, arrange flowers, work in her garden and cook wonderful meals for family and friends. She especially loved spending time with her family. If a child could hand pick who they would want for a mother she would be that choice.
